Written Answers. - Shannon River Interests Co-ordination.

51.

asked the Minister for Finance if he intends to set up a Shannon river authority to co-ordinate all the different interests along the River Shannon and its catchment areas.

At the launch of the IFA consultant's report on the River Shannon, in Athlone, I announced the establishment of a forum to co-ordinate the views of the various bodies interested in this great natural watercourse. I am now happy to report that I have since written to the various interests, inviting all concerned to take part. So far the response to my letters has been positive and, in the circumstances, I would hope to be in a position to call the inaugural meeting of the forum shortly.
